Description

Hyalopeziza is a group of tiny cup-shaped fungi found on decaying plant material. They are often translucent or whitish in color, giving them a delicate appearance. Some species in this group have unique hair-like structures on their fruiting bodies. Hyalopeziza plays a role in decomposition processes in various ecosystems, contributing to nutrient cycling in forest environments.
